O R D E R
This Criminal Original Petition has been filed to quash the proceedings in C.C.No.85 of 2013, on the file of the learned Judicial Magistrate, Ottanchathiram.
2. Though the learned counsel appearing for the petitioners raised several grounds for quashing the proceedings in C.C.No.85 of 2013, he submitted that it would suffice, if a direction is issued to the trial Court to complete the trial within a time limit that may be stipulated by this Court and also to permit the petitioners to raise all the grounds raised in this petition before the trial Court. However, he requested the appearance of the petitioners may be dispensed with before the https://hcservices.ecourts.gov.in/hcservices/
Trial Court.
3. I have heard the learned Government Advocate (Criminal side) appearing for the first respondent, who has also conceded the request of the learned counsel for the petitioners. 4.In the light of the above said submissions of the learned counsel appearing for the petitioners, this Court, without going into the merits of the case, directs the learned Judicial Magistrate, Ottanchathiram, to complete the trial in C.C.No.85 of 2013 within a period of three months from the date of receipt of a copy of this order. Meanwhile, the appearance of the petitioner nos. 2 to 4 is dispensed with unless the learned Judicial Magistrate feels that their presence is required for the disposal of the case.
5. With the above direction, this Criminal Original Petition is disposed of. Consequently, the connected Miscellaneous Petition is closed.
